How To Fix CRM_BUPA_FRG0070500 - Partner function with internal identification &1 does not exist


SAP Error Message - Details

  • Message type: E = Error

  • Message class: CRM_BUPA_FRG0070 - Service BP Excluded Functions List

  • Message number: 500

  • Message text: Partner function with internal identification &1 does not exist

  • Show details Hide details
  • What causes this issue?

    You tried to work with a partner function &V1& that is not defined. This
    error can also occur when no description for the partner function &V1&
    exists in the language used.

    How to fix this error?

    Create a corresponding partner function with the specified abbreviation
    in Customizing or enter the missing description.
    Check your call.

  • What is the cause and solution for SAP error message CRM_BUPA_FRG0070500 - Partner function with internal identification &1 does not exist ?

    The SAP error message CRM_BUPA_FRG0070500 indicates that a partner function with the specified internal identification does not exist in the system. This error typically occurs in the context of Customer Relationship Management (CRM) when trying to assign or reference a partner function that has not been defined or is not available in the system.

    Cause:

    1. Missing Partner Function Definition: The partner function you are trying to use has not been defined in the system.
    2. Incorrect Partner Function ID: The internal identification (&1) provided may be incorrect or misspelled.
    3. Data Inconsistency: There may be inconsistencies in the data, such as missing entries in the relevant tables.
    4. Configuration Issues: The partner function may not be properly configured in the system settings.
